The Real Problem SSL Buyers Actually Have
When people email about SSL certificates, they usually pitch features - "EV verification," "wildcard support," "256-bit encryption," "99.9% uptime SLA." None of this matters to the person opening the email.
What actually matters depends on who you're reaching. If you're going after IT operations or DevOps teams at mid-market companies (100-2,000 people), they care about one thing: certificate expiration causing downtime. This isn't theoretical. A certificate expiration that breaks a customer-facing service is a production incident. It means a page goes down, customers can't access the product, and someone gets paged at 2 AM.
For security teams or CISOs, the problem is compliance and audit friction - proving they have valid certificates across all systems, managing certificate inventory, ensuring nothing expires uncovered.
Your email should start with the specific pain, not the feature. "We help DevOps teams eliminate certificate expiration incidents" beats "Industry-leading SSL certificate management" every single time.
Who to Email and How to Find Them
Most SSL vendors email the wrong people. They hit up CTOs or security directors - smart people, but the wrong stakeholder. These people are busy and don't manage day-to-day certificate operations.
Target three roles:
- DevOps engineers and infrastructure leads - These people own the systems that need certificates. They're woken up by certificate expirations. They care about automation that prevents incidents.
- IT operations managers - They run the infrastructure team. They see the cost and time drain of manual certificate management across dozens or hundreds of domains.
- Security operations managers - They own certificate inventory and compliance auditing. They're tired of running manual scans to find expiring certificates.
Finding these people is straightforward. Use LinkedIn to search companies by size (target 150-2,000 employees - small enough to have real pain points, large enough to have budget). Search for titles like "DevOps Lead," "Infrastructure Manager," "IT Operations Manager," "Security Operations Manager," "Release Engineering Lead." Pull 50-100 names per company vertical (SaaS, financial services, e-commerce, healthcare tech).
For DevOps and infrastructure people, focus on tech-forward verticals: SaaS, fintech, e-commerce, healthcare tech. These companies have internal infrastructure and certificate management problems. For IT ops managers, broaden it - any mid-market company with 200+ employees probably has this pain.
The Email Structure That Works
Your cold email needs three parts: acknowledgment of the specific pain, proof that other similar companies solved it, and a low-friction next step.
Here's the structure:
Subject line: Keep it simple and specific to their role. Don't mention SSL certificates or your company name.
Certificate expirations costing your team time?
or
Quick question on certificate automation
Opening (2 lines max): Show you know their specific situation. If you're emailing a DevOps lead at a SaaS company, reference that context.
Hi [Name] - I work with DevOps teams at companies like [similar company] who were burning hours on manual certificate renewals and incident response. Figured it might be relevant since you're likely managing the same across [Company Name]'s infrastructure.
Problem paragraph (2-3 sentences): Name the actual cost of the problem, not the feature gap.
The issue isn't getting certificates - it's the operational overhead. Most teams we talk to spend 4-6 hours per month manually renewing certs across domains, tracking expiration dates in spreadsheets, and handling the occasional outage when something slips through. We've seen that cost scale quickly as a company grows.
Solution sentence (1 line): Name what you do in operational terms, not technical terms.
We've built a system that automatically renews certificates and alerts your team 90 days before expiration - the idea is to eliminate the whole renewal process from your plate.
Proof (1-2 sentences): Reference a similar company or specific outcome, not a generic case study.
Teams like [Company] went from managing renewals manually to fully automated, which freed up about 5-8 hours per team member per quarter.
Close (1 sentence): Ask a specific, low-friction question that gets a yes or no answer.
Does automated certificate renewal and 90-day alerts sound useful for your setup, or is that already covered?
Here's a full example email:
Hi [Name], I work with DevOps teams at companies like [Company A] and [Company B] who were burning hours on manual certificate renewals. Figured it might be relevant since you're likely managing the same across [Prospect Company]'s infrastructure. The issue isn't getting certificates - it's the operational overhead. Most teams spend 4-6 hours per month renewing certs across domains, tracking expiration dates, and handling the occasional outage when something slips through. We've built automation that renews certificates and alerts 90 days before expiration - the idea is to eliminate the whole renewal process. Teams like [Company] went from manual renewals to fully automated, which freed up about 5-8 hours per person per quarter. Does automated renewal and 90-day alerts sound useful for your setup, or is that already handled? [Your name]
Expectations and Timing
SSL certificate vendors typically see 8-12% response rates on cold email to the right buyer (DevOps/IT Ops leads at mid-market companies). Of those responses, about 15-20% convert to a first call. That means roughly 1-2 meetings per 100 emails sent to qualified targets.
If you're sending to 50 people per week, expect 4-6 responses and 1 qualified meeting. That scales predictably - 200 emails per week gets you 4-5 meetings.
Send your email sequences on a 7-day, 14-day, and 21-day cadence. Keep follow-ups short - they should acknowledge that your first email might have gotten buried and reference a single new reason to engage (a new automation feature, an article about certificate management costs, a relevant industry news hook).
